I've got coolent dribbling from the back left hand cylynder head nut, is it a really bad sign or should I just replace the gasket and returque it all up?
it's running fine...should I fix it soon?

get a new gasket and torque it back up, if its the base gasket, u'll need to replace the head gasket as well. best do it soon cos u dont want it to overheat and cause more damage. its an easy job
